Soccer with Aldwin


Indoors at the Bendheim Western Greenwich Civic Center


 The Department of Parks and Recreation announces that Soccer with Aldwin will be having an indoor session at the Bendheim Western Greenwich Civic Center starting January 23rd for seven weeks.  Registration for this popular class will begin by mail only on Wednesday, January 2, 2013.  In person registration will begin on Monday January 14th.

The program meets on Wednesday s beginning January 23 for 7 weeks.  Children 4 and 5 years old meet from 3:15 – 4pm, and children 6 and 7 meet from 4pm – 4:45pm.  The cost for the seven week program is $150.00

The Soccer with Aldwin program is a unique training program that focuses on teaching the fundamentals of soccer in a fun environment.  The players will practice kicking, passing, ball control, dribbling, shooting, agility, coordination, and much more.  For over 20 years soccer with Aldwin has been running fun filled training programs throughout Connecticut and New York.
